(3) 1981 Chevrolet Scottsdale Stepside (After Rebuild)

Twlman
June 5, 2009
 12
 0
This is what we ended up with in August 1999. I replaced the factory rubber flooring with carpeting. I installed a tilt steering column and a guage cluster from a 1977 Blazer with a factory tach. I replaced all of the emblems, door opening rubbers, door, glove box and ashtray bumpers and inner and outer window sashes. I installed a Pioneer Truck Rides Series head unit and a Pioneer CD changer in a custom box behind the new (Per-owned) bucket seat unit with a fold down center seat with console. We made and installed Red oak in the interior and in the box floor fastening it down with hand made stainless strips. Another friend did a little airbrushing on the tailgate. I installed new Michelin LTX M/S 32 X 11.5 x 15 on American Racing rims. Read more ยป
